The package includes a single, high-resolution PNG file with dimensions of 4096 by 4096 pixels. This size is crucial for maintaining quality across different scales—from a small sticker on a laptop to a large print on a poster or t-shirt. The transparent background is perhaps its most valuable feature for designers and entrepreneurs. It allows the graphic to be seamlessly layered onto any color or pattern without a distracting white box, integrating perfectly into your existing brand palette or project layout.

Best Practices for Using Your Design Files
To get the most out of your download, a few practical steps are recommended. First, always check the final output quality at the size you intend to use it. While 4096x4096 pixels is large, testing a mockup on your specific product or screen ensures everything looks perfect. Second, think about font pairing if you plan to add text. The design's style will suggest whether a clean sans serif font or a more decorative display font would work best to maintain readability and visual harmony.
Finally, be mindful of licensing. The package note indicates this is for commercial use, which is essential for anyone creating products for sale. Always verify the specific terms to ensure your project, whether it's selling t-shirts on Etsy or using the graphic in a client's marketing assets, is fully covered. This due diligence protects your business and allows you to create with confidence.
